This complex VariableType is used for information about frames in 3D space. It reflects the semantic of its DataType, defined in 12.30. It refines the DataTypes and VariableTypes of the CartesianCoordinates and Orientation to the corresponding 3D types. The VariableType is formally defined in Table 94.
Table 94 – 3DFrameType Definition
Attribute |
Value |
|||||
BrowseName |
3DFrameType |
|||||
IsAbstract |
False |
|||||
ValueRank |
Scalar |
|||||
DataType |
3DFrame |
|||||
References |
NodeClass |
BrowseName |
DataType |
TypeDefinition |
Modelling Rule |
|
Subtype of the FrameType defined in 7.27. |
||||||
HasComponent |
Variable |
CartesianCoordinates |
3DCartesianCoordinates |
3DCartesianCoordinatesType |
Mandatory |
|
HasComponent |
Variable |
Orientation |
3DOrientation |
3DOrientationType |
Mandatory |
|
Conformance Units |
||||||
Base Info Spatial Data |